Acute antipsychotic-induced akathisia revisited.

Michael Poyurovsky.   

Abstract

Akathisia remains one of the most prevalent and distressful antipsychotic-induced adverse events. Effective and well-tolerated treatment is a major unmet need in akathisia that merits a search for new remedies. Accumulating evidence indicates that agents with marked serotonin-2A receptor antagonism may represent a new class of potential anti-akathisia treatment.
